In steel production, oxygen is a high-risk, high-value process medium. From converter oxygen blowing to oxygen pipeline distribution, plants require high-pressure oxygen shut-off valves that can withstand extreme operating conditions while maintaining zero leakage, stable performance, and consistent safety.

Oxygen Copper Valves: Core Benefits for Steelmaking Safety and Uptime

Steel mills choose oxygen copper valves because oxygen service places unique requirements on valve design and manufacturing discipline. The right oxygen shut-off valve helps you:

  • Reduce oxygen leakage risk and prevent abnormal oxygen loss

  • Improve operational stability for oxygen distribution networks

  • Support safer maintenance and shutdown procedures

  • Protect critical equipment by ensuring reliable isolation under pressure

When oxygen control fails, consequences can include safety incidents, unplanned downtime, and production instability. That’s why plant engineers and procurement teams often search specifically for high-pressure oxygen copper valves rather than general-purpose shut-off valves.


Where These Valves Are Used in the Steel Industry

High-pressure oxygen copper valves are commonly specified for:

  • Steel mill oxygen pipelines and high-pressure oxygen stations

  • Converter shop oxygen isolation and emergency shutoff points

  • High-flow oxygen supply headers requiring large diameter valves

  • Upgrades and retrofits where pressure rating and size are limiting factors

  • Critical isolation positions where “zero leakage” is required by internal standards

How to Specify a High-Pressure Oxygen Copper Valve

To shorten RFQ cycles and avoid re-selection, confirm these parameters before ordering:

  1. Nominal size (DN) and connection standard (flange type, face-to-face requirements)

  2. Operating pressure and design pressure, including surge conditions

  3. Operating temperature range and environmental exposure

  4. Operation method (manual, gear, pneumatic, electric) and emergency shutoff requirements

  5. Oxygen service compliance requirements, including cleaning, inspection, and documentation expectations

  6. Cycle frequency (how often the valve opens/closes per shift/day) to align with durability targets

  7. Installation constraints (space, weight, actuator clearance)

This information helps match valve structure, sealing design, and configuration to your real steelmaking conditions.
